| Vehicle Type | Capacity | Ideal For | Extra Features |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mini Party Bus | 12-16 | Small groups wanting intimate atmosphere | Sound system, mood lighting |
| Standard Party Bus | 20-30 | Medium groups, mixed friend circles | Dance floor, bars, high-quality sound |
| Luxury Limo | 8-10 | Smaller groups, more formal arrivals | Leather seats, privacy screens |
